Arizona State transfer QB Brady White gets another year of eligibility tacked on at Memphis

Memphis will have the services of Brady White for a little while longer than initially thought.

When White grad transferred from Arizona State to Memphis in January of 2018, it was thought that the quarterback would have two seasons of eligibility to use with the Tigers. Thursday, however, head coach Mike Norvell confirmed that White has been granted a sixth year of eligibility because of medical issues at ASU.

As a result, White will be eligible to play for the Tigers in both 2019 and 2020.

In his first season as the Tigers’ starting quarterback in 2018, White passed for 3,296 yards, 26 touchdowns and nine interceptions. White enters the summer as U-M’s unquestioned starter under center.
